    Boosting metabolism to jump start weight loss requires two things: adequate energy demands on our cells to encourage the physiological mechanisms that increase metabolism (i.e. exercise, both cardio and strength training) and the fuel that cells need to function if their metabolic rate is to increase (i.e. adequate calories). I'm 37 and a biology professor (hence my analytical beginning), have been using MFP since mid-April, and am more than halfway to my primary goal. I've gotten into cycling and running and will be taking on my first 5K in three weeks. My focus is on permanent lifestyle change, which means I don't eat 100% healthy 100% of the time...I like pizza and pie too much to give them up for good...but I emphasize moderation in diet, responsible eating related to exercise (i.e. I eat back nearly all my exercise calories), and responsible training regimens in which I push myself hard but don't risk injury by pushing my limits every time.
